Eylsia Celebrates Creativity on “Music in My Head”
“Music in My Head” is like a love letter to being creative. Eylsia‘s latest single shows music as a living thing, a force that flows with breath, heartbeat, and emotion. The end result is a song that feels personal, thoughtful, and very honest.
The song is about how creativity never really stops. Eylsia lives with it. That idea is the emotional core of “Music in My Head,” and it gives the song a warm, steady feeling that stays with you long after it’s over.
The song has a soft, heartfelt quality that makes it feel personal without being closed off. Instead, it invites people into Eylsia’s world, where music flows freely, and every note is guided by love for the art form. The song’s clear emotions make it easy to connect with, especially for people who see creativity as an important part of who they are.
“Music in My Head” shows how Eylsia can turn feelings into sound. It’s about respecting the link between feelings and words. This release strengthens her position as an artist who makes music from the heart and reminds us that music is a living thing.

Karate Boogaloo delivers a slow-burning soul on new release “Head First”
Karate Boogaloo’s latest release, “Head First,” is inspired by deep soul traditions, but it still feels very modern. It’s clear right away what the band means when they say the song is a stripped-down, garage-style version of cinematic soul. The way it was made is rough; nothing feels overproduced or forced, but the emotional weight is still rich and full.
The arrangement slowly unfolds, with soft grooves and delicate melodic phrasing guiding it. Instead of going for big crescendos, Karate Boogaloo focuses on mood, creating a sound that feels personal and thoughtful. This music makes you want to sit with it, take in its textures, and let its quiet confidence sink in.
The balance in “Head First” is what makes it so interesting. It is both simple and full, controlled and full of emotionm the band’s ability to create cinematic depth with such a simple style shows how good they are at music and how well they understand space.

STEVE TURNER unveils a country song about loss and quiet strength on “How Do I Walk in This World?”
Steve Turner gives us a deeply reflective moment in “How Do I Walk in This World?”. The track is about grief, memory, and not knowing what to do next. The song has a sense of stillness that fits its theme and is rooted in acoustic country music. It starts with echoes of guidance, which are memories of someone who used to give you direction and a sense of stability.
The main question that runs through the whole piece is “How do I walk in this world?” The simplicity is honest, the arrangement doesn’t make things too much, it helps. The sound elements create a space where feelings can exist without interruption, so each moment feels real and personal.
The song works because it doesn’t offer answers; instead, it recognizes the struggle. It knows that moving on after a loss isn’t about being sure, it’s about taking the next step, even when the way isn’t clear. Steve Turner gives people who are learning a sense of recognition.
